Vereinigte Staaten vs Deutschland: Analysis

Vereinigte Staaten has a larger economy than Deutschland, with a nominal GDP roughly 6.1 times greater based on 2024 data. Vereinigte Staaten recorded a GDP of $28.75T, while Deutschland stood at $4.69T.

In terms of GDP per capita, Vereinigte Staaten leads over Deutschland. Vereinigte Staaten has a per capita output of $84,534, compared to $56,104 for Deutschland.

Vereinigte Staaten has a larger population than Deutschland. Vereinigte Staaten is home to approximately 340.1M people, while Deutschland has about 83.5M.

By surface area, Vereinigte Staaten is the larger country. Vereinigte Staaten covers 9,831,510 km2, and Deutschland spans 357,680 km2.

Life expectancy is higher in Deutschland: 78.4 years in Vereinigte Staaten versus 80.5 years in Deutschland. Deutschland has the lower unemployment rate (Vereinigte Staaten: 4.20%, Deutschland: 3.71%). Inflation stands at 2.95% in Vereinigte Staaten and 2.26% in Deutschland.
